Who It's For
The Gold Armour Rainfly Tarp suits thru-hikers, ultralight backpackers and campers who prioritize low weight but still want robust rain protection and flexible use. It is especially useful for people who sleep in hammocks or who need a large footprint to cover gear, create shade or rig a communal shelter at a campsite.
People who want a heavy-duty, permanently rigid tent or those who need a fully sealed floor and integrated bug netting should look elsewhere, since this product is a tarp shelter and not a freestanding tent system with built-in floors or screens.

Specifications
| Brand | Gold Armour |
| Available sizes | 14.7ft x 12ft, 12ft x 10ft, 10ft x 10ft, 10ft x 8ft |
| Waterproof rating | 5,000mm |
| Tie down points | 33 loops |
| Included accessories | Stakes, ropes, tensioners, rain proof gear sack |
| Material features | Ripstop, ultralight construction |
